Pointer manipulation via stale finalizer source
Published May 19, 2026 · Updated May 19, 2026
Use-after-free in Samsung Escargot 590345cc6258317c5da850d846ce6baaf2afc2d3 allows local users to manipulate pointers via crafted JavaScript. Unordered garbage-collector finalizers can collect a FinalizationRegistry before its targets, causing a target finalizer to dereference the registry through a stale source pointer. Exploitation requires local execution and user interaction; successful pointer manipulation can compromise process data or crash the hosting process.
